We have an exciting opportunity for an Oil Lab Technician to join our team in Nottingham, As part of the RS Oil Testing laboratory services team, you will perform time critical analytical testing in accordance with specified standards and in accordance with the company’s accreditations and approvals.
The oil analysis laboratory offers oil, fluid testing and specialist analytical services to customers across the world, providing insight into the condition of the machines from which the samples have been taken. A range of analytical techniques are used to monitor and assess fluid condition and chemistry, as well as troubleshooting issues as they develop and providing root cause analysis of specialist samples.
